    After recently dealing with a great deal of turmoil in my life, I landed in Kansas City to spend time with some relatives.  I'm ashamed to say it, but I pretty much completely stopped practicing my kung fu for weeks at a time.  I guess this was partly because it was hard to find a decent place to practice.  I couldn't really find any good indoor gyms in my area that were ideal and it was so unbearably hot outside, that I'd be drenched in sweat after ten minutes.

    I took these videos to mark my progress with these particular forms.  This one is called "Entering The Gate".  It's quite difficult to do under the best circumstances.  In this case, it was 98 degrees outside!  Not to mention it was so humid you could hardly breath.  I can't say that I've really worked out all of the kinks in this form yet and after something like five takes I settled on this one:
    Video: http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=0J1b_zYsxpw&feature=channel_page

    This is the same "Plum Blossom" form that I posted earlier.  I feel this video shows that I've vastly improved with this one.  I can actually use the strikes rather than just go through motions like I'm using them.  I finally have a "snap" at the end of each punch, chop, kick, and throat gouge that I didn't before:
